The Benefits of Aluminum Containers
1. Sustainability: Aluminum is infinitely recyclable without losing its quality, making it a sustainable choice for eco-conscious consumers and businesses. Unlike single-use plastics, aluminum containers can be recycled repeatedly, reducing environmental impact and promoting a circular economy.
2. Durability: Aluminum containers are sturdy and resistant to corrosion, ensuring that they can withstand various temperatures and conditions. This durability makes them ideal for both hot and cold food items, catering to diverse culinary needs.
3. Food Safety: Unlike some plastics that may leach harmful chemicals into food, aluminum containers are non-reactive and provide a protective barrier against contaminants. This property is particularly important for preserving the flavor and quality of delicate or acidic foods.
4. Versatility: Aluminum containers come in various shapes and sizes, offering versatility in packaging different types of foods. Whether it’s takeaway meals, frozen foods, or fresh produce, these containers can be customized to meet specific requirements while maintaining food integrity.

Consumer Trends and Market Insights
The demand for convenient, sustainable packaging solutions is driving market trends towards:
1. On-the-Go Convenience: Consumers prefer portable, easy-to-carry packaging for meals and snacks, influencing the design and size specifications of aluminum containers.
2. Health and Wellness: Increasingly, consumers are looking for packaging that supports healthy eating habits, such as portion-controlled containers and options for storing fresh ingredients.
3. Brand Transparency: Brands that emphasize sustainable practices and ethical sourcing of materials are gaining consumer trust and loyalty in a competitive market.
